117.info
人生若只如初见

python中的sample函数怎么使用

在Python中,sample函数用于从给定的序列中随机选择指定数量的元素。它的语法如下:

random.sample(sequence, k)

其中,sequence是要选择的序列,可以是一个列表、元组或字符串,k是要选择的元素数量。

以下是使用sample函数的示例代码:

import random

# 从列表中随机选择两个元素
my_list = [1, 2, 3, 4, 5]
random_elements = random.sample(my_list, 2)
print(random_elements)

# 从字符串中随机选择三个字符
my_string = "Hello, World!"
random_chars = random.sample(my_string, 3)
print(random_chars)

输出:

[4, 1]
['l', 'o', 'l']

在上面的示例中,sample函数从列表中选择了两个随机元素,并从字符串中选择了三个随机字符。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e050AzsLAA5WBFI.html

推荐文章

  • python如何把列表转换为字典

    在Python中,可以使用zip()函数和字典推导式将两个列表转换为字典。
    假设有两个列表keys和values,其中keys包含键,values包含相应的值。可以使用以下代码将...

  • python怎么对字典按照值排序

    可以使用sorted()函数对字典按照值进行排序。sorted()函数接受一个可迭代对象作为参数,并返回一个新的已排序的列表。对于字典,可以使用items()方法将其转换为可...

  • python中add函数的用法是什么

    在Python中,add函数通常用于执行数字相加的操作。它可以用于两个数字相加,也可以用于多个数字相加。
    以下是add函数的用法示例: 两个数字相加: result =...

  • python中字典的items方法怎么使用

    字典的items()方法可以用来返回字典的键值对(key-value)的元组(tuple)列表。
    下面是使用items()方法的示例代码:
    # 定义一个字典
    person = {...

  • Kotlin语言的主要特点有哪些

    Kotlin语言的主要特点包括: 与Java无缝互操作性:Kotlin可以与Java代码无缝地互操作,可以直接使用Java类和库,并且可以在Java项目中逐步引入Kotlin代码。 简洁...

  • swift怎么判断两个结构体是否相等

    在 Swift 中,可以通过遵循 Equatable 协议来判断两个结构体是否相等。
    首先,需要为结构体实现 Equatable 协议,并定义相等运算符(==)的实现。以下是一个...

  • jmeter中csv参数化设置的方法是什么

    在JMeter中,有几种方法可以设置CSV参数化。
    方法1:使用CSV Data Set Config元件 在测试计划中右键单击添加->Config Element->CSV Data Set Config。

  • c++标识符的命名规则是什么

    C++标识符的命名规则如下: 只能由字母(a-z、A-Z)、数字(0-9)和下划线(_)组成。
    必须以字母或下划线开头,不能以数字开头。
    区分大小写,标识符...